Multi Vendor Support Services bring multiple vendor-managed environments under one governed operating workflow by mapping vendor outputs into a consistent data model for incidents, assets, change records, and service requests. Providers like NTT DATA and IBM Consulting emphasize schema-aware integration so tickets, provisioning events, and change control artifacts stay aligned across heterogeneous systems.

These services address the operational failure modes that show up when each vendor exposes different schemas, event formats, and admin actions. Enterprises typically use them to run governed automation and cross-system orchestration across support ecosystems, where RBAC and audit log requirements must tie admin actions to traceable operational records.

Provider-selection pitfalls that break multi-vendor control and automation

Common failures come from assuming that automation and integration depth exist without verifying schema mapping coverage and the actual API and event hooks needed for provisioning. Several providers call out that automation depth depends on vendor API endpoints, event feeds, or interface readiness.

Another recurring issue is governance that slows emergency workflows because approvals and audit requirements are not validated against the operational cadence needed for incident and change handling.
